You are viewing a plain text version of this content. The canonical link for it is here.
Posted to oak-commits@jackrabbit.apache.org by md...@apache.org on 2012/09/07 17:13:33 UTC
svn commit: r1382063 -
/jackrabbit/oak/trunk/oak-core/src/main/java/org/apache/jackrabbit/oak/plugins/type/constraint/StringConstraint.java
Author: mduerig
Date: Fri Sep 7 15:13:33 2012
New Revision: 1382063
URL: http://svn.apache.org/viewvc?rev=1382063&view=rev
Log:
TODO
Modified:
jackrabbit/oak/trunk/oak-core/src/main/java/org/apache/jackrabbit/oak/plugins/type/constraint/StringConstraint.java
Modified: jackrabbit/oak/trunk/oak-core/src/main/java/org/apache/jackrabbit/oak/plugins/type/constraint/StringConstraint.java
URL: http://svn.apache.org/viewvc/jackrabbit/oak/trunk/oak-core/src/main/java/org/apache/jackrabbit/oak/plugins/type/constraint/StringConstraint.java?rev=1382063&r1=1382062&r2=1382063&view=diff
==============================================================================
--- jackrabbit/oak/trunk/oak-core/src/main/java/org/apache/jackrabbit/oak/plugins/type/constraint/StringConstraint.java (original)
+++ jackrabbit/oak/trunk/oak-core/src/main/java/org/apache/jackrabbit/oak/plugins/type/constraint/StringConstraint.java Fri Sep 7 15:13:33 2012
@@ -35,9 +35,8 @@ public class StringConstraint implements
public StringConstraint(String definition) {
Pattern p;
try {
- // FIXME matching case insensitive as a workaround
- // forJSR-283: character case mismatch between property type names and node type definitions
- // see http://markmail.org/message/asyaqqkn5nucvcjk
+ // FIXME matching case insensitive as a workaround for
+ // for OAK-294: nt:propertyDefinition has incorrect value constraints for property types
int ignoreCase = Pattern.CASE_INSENSITIVE | Pattern.UNICODE_CASE;
p = Pattern.compile(definition, ignoreCase);
}